Web2 days ago · Megalopapilla (MP) is a rare congenital anomaly that is characterized by an enlarged nerve head and abnormal disc shape. MP can mimic glaucomatous changes of the optic nerve and can occur in one or both eyes.1–3 MP is a benign condition with unknown etiology, but it has been reported in individuals with congenital glaucoma, basal ...

Glaucoma can cause the cup to enlarge (actually little nerve fibers are being wiped out along the rim of the optic nerve in glaucoma). Some doctors refer to an enlarged cup/disc ratio as cupping or a cupped nerve. Glaucoma typically causes the cup to get bigger in a vertical oval type pattern. simplified ipr hmrcWebYou also need to consider this in context of the overall size of the optic nerve. In a very small nerve, the cup will naturally be much smaller, so even a ratio of 0.4 may be suspicious.
